What Is Matrine?
Matrine is a naturally occurring alkaloid extracted from the roots of Sophora flavescens, a plant with a long history in Traditional Chinese Medicine (TCM). For centuries, this botanical has been used to support overall health, particularly in promoting comfort and a steady mood. Modern research identifies matrine as the primary active compound behind many of these traditional applications. Unlike some other alkaloids, matrine’s distinctive chemical structure allows it to interact with a variety of biological pathways. What is the difference between matrine and oxymatrine?
Oxymatrine is an oxidised derivative of matrine. Both occur naturally in Sophora flavescens, but matrine is considered the primary active alkaloid. They may have slightly different biological activities; this product contains pure matrine.
